Ten burning questions for Seahawks QB Matt Hasselbeck

Zachary HabnerMay 15, 2009

Not many people can say they have had a herniated disk.  Even fewer can say they came back to play quarterback in the NFL.  One man will try to do just that this season.

 

Given the opportunity to interview the franchise quarterback of the Seattle Seahawks, here are the ten questions I would ask.

 

 

1.  What do you feel was your defining moment while playing for Seattle?  Was it leading them to their first playoff victory in 21 years?  The Super Bowl?  Or was it a different moment?

 

2.  Recently, Shaun Alexander has told us how he felt about how his situation ended in Seattle.  Do you feel as if he was treated unfairly, or that it was just time for a change of scenery?

 

3.  Your team went out and signed T.J. Houshmandzadeh to help shore up the WR core.  What does he bring that is different to this offense?

 

4.  What do you feel was the one thing that Mike Holmgren said or taught you that you will remember the rest of your career?  What is your favorite memory of coach Holmgren?

 

5.  Tell us how you felt when you were benched in favor of Trent Dilfer.  Did you feel like you weren’t cut out to play in Seattle or did it just fuel your fire to prove the fans wrong?

 

6.  The whole country heard your proclamation in Green Bay.  What did that loss feel like as a player knowing that your season was over in the blink of an eye?

 

7.  What was it like in the huddle during that 2005 season?  How was that season different from any other season?

 

8.  What was it like to throw the ball during that Monday Night Football game in 2007? In which Mike Holmgren abandoned the run and proclaimed “we are going to throw the ball.”

 

9.  Tell me about Super Bowl media day in Detroit.  What was the strangest thing you can remember from that day?  What was the strangest question you got asked that day?

 

10.  What are the plans after football?  Do you follow your brother’s path and end up on NFL Live?  Or do you follow your Sister-in-Law’s path and go on day time TV?

 

Hopefully, that last question gets a classic Matt Hasselbeck response.
